will C6 bolt up to 4.9L?

Will an 1984 bronco C6 bolt up to a 1992 4.9L engine? I got all the parts i need for a 2x4 to 4x4 conversion but i don't have the 351 built yet so i want to bolt up the C6 and transfer case to the I6 temporarily. I imagine everything else should work after i figure out how to rig up a tv cable. Also does the vacuum modulator on the C6 need ported vacuum?

Yes, 4.9 has the 289/302/351 bolt pattern and it will bolt up, you'll just need the proper flex plate.

The bolt patterns sre the same. The BALANCE is different and tooth count may be. 300s are zero balanced. 351s run a 28.2 oz-in imbalance. Check the tooth count. The 351 could be 157T or 164T. 300s are normally 164T. The flexplates can only be used with the appropriate sized bellhousings, they will not interchange.
